In July, the Global Olympic Committee announced that ski mountaineering will make its Olympic debut at the 2026 Winter season Games in Milano-Cortina, Italy. The changeover from niche backcountry enthusiasm to a supply of five Olympic medals will provide new attention to the sport—including from sporting activities experts. To kick matters off, a staff of scientists led by Lorenzo Bortolan of Italy’s College of Verona (alongside with colleagues from Sweden and Slovenia) just posted a primer on what’s at the moment recognised about skimo, as the activity is recognised to the cognoscenti, in the journal Frontiers in Physiology. Below are some highlights:

The Fundamentals

Skimo will involve climbing mountains, typically on skis equipped with non-slip skins. There are also some technical sections, for instance alongside ridges and couloirs, in which you climb on foot with your skis strapped to your backpack. And the payoff is skiing back down the mountain with your skins removed.

The Olympic plan contains a men’s and women’s sprint, which typically will involve a single ascent of about 250 vertical ft, then skiing back down, with a whole period of three to three.5 minutes. There’s also a men’s and women’s personal occasion which lasts one.5 to 2 several hours and will involve at minimum a few ascents and descents, with a whole vertical achieve of a mile or far more and skis-off technical sections totaling up to ten per cent of the race. Last but not least, there’s a mixed-gender relay long lasting about 15 minutes.

The Physiology

It can take a whole lot extended to skin up a mountain than it does to ski down it. That suggests it is mostly an stamina activity. If you are a couple of per cent improved than your rivals at climbing, you are going to achieve minutes on them if you are a couple of per cent improved at descending, you are going to only achieve seconds. Absolutely sure plenty of, in an Austrian examine posted previously this yr, the best predictor of race functionality in a team of elite and sub-elite skimo racers was how they did in a ski-specific VO2 max exam. Major execs reportedly practice 16 to 24 several hours a 7 days through foundation periods, about 50 percent on skis and the relaxation biking, managing, and roller skiing. In a specified yr, they’ll rack up a hundred and fifty to a hundred ninety miles of vertical.

Of program, downhill proficiency also issues. You have to be fantastic plenty of to make it down some fairly complicated slopes without the need of bailing or snowplowing the total way. This is not trivial: an additional examine located that coronary heart price stays all-around 85 per cent of max even through the descents—in element, the authors compose, due to “the psycho-emotional and physical anxiety connected with deciding upon the ideal trajectory on the demanding program with various snow ailments.”

Altitude is an additional aspect to take into consideration. While the principles for cross-place skiing situations at the Olympics restrict the elevation to a tiny under 6,000 ft over sea degree, skimo doesn’t have an upper restrict. Functions frequently consider place at 10,000 ft and from time to time as superior as thirteen,000 ft. For every three,000 ft of elevation, VO2 max declines by about six per cent, and some folks (in certain really experienced athletes) are impacted far more than others—so your ability to cope with thin mountain air could be a limiting aspect.

Last but not least, pounds issues because you have to lug it uphill, so reports have located an inverse correlation between overall body excess fat and race time. That also influences gear selections, which we’ll get to under.

The Biomechanics

Skinning up a mountain appears a whole lot like the traditional cross-place skiing system, the principal distinctions remaining that your skins do not actually glide uphill, and if you lose your grip you are going to tumble hundreds of ft to your loss of life. (All right, not very, although a rule that goes into outcome in 2022 stipulates that bindings should have a safety system that instantly stops the ski if it will come off—an innovation I would have appreciated in my very own extremely restricted experience!)

For the reason that of the lack of glide imposed by skins, ski mountaineers consider shorter, a lot quicker strides than cross-place skiers. And when the terrain gets steeper, they shorten the strides even further and slow them down. In comparison, cross-place skiers are likely to continue to keep their stride frequency roughly consistent and regulate their velocity by altering only stride duration. Upper-overall body toughness and system for poling uphill is also critical.

On the downhills, ski mountaineers do not get into as deep a tuck as alpine skiers, both of those because the terrain is a whole lot far more uneven and unpredictable and, let us be sincere, because their legs are still shot from the uphill.

The Equipment

Excess weight issues: an excess kilogram (2.2 kilos) at the ankles of a ski mountaineer burns two to a few per cent far more strength. Security also issues, which is why the Global Ski Mountaineering Federation has a extremely lengthy and thorough listing of specifications for expected gear to avoid athletes from competing to have on the lightest and flimsiest tools. In certain, there are least weights for ski boots (one,000 grams for adult males, 900 for women) and skis and bindings (one,five hundred grams for adult males, one,400 for women).

You also have to pack an permitted snow shovel, snow probe, survival blanket, whistle, crampons, and avalanche detector, and have a least range of garments layers. Bortolan’s paper has a pleasant infographic providing the information.

So what remains to be found between now and 2026? Bortolan and his colleagues level to environmental ailments as a existing blindspot. How do superior altitudes, chilly temperatures, and various snow ailments impact the calls for of a race and dictate the best way to prepare for it? Wearable tech that is exclusively optimized to gather related data on pacing and effort and hard work through skimo operates will present a far more thorough picture of what athletes are going through. Superior tools that boosts functionality and simplifies the transitions between skinning, mountaineering, and downhill skiing will undoubtedly emerge.
